How is hearing impairment determined in an infant?

Hearing impairment can be determined in an infant by doing early screening and diagnosis after birth. Screening can be done with 1 or 2 tests. Both measure how a baby respond to sound and it takes 5 - 10 min and is also painless. Hearing impairment can only be diagnosed by specialist.


What is the comprehensive panel metabolic screening for newborn babies?

Comprehensive panel metabolic screening is done on newborn babies to test for genetic disorders from birth. The panel comprises of many rare metabolic disorders which individually might occure very rare but when seen collectively the occurrence increase many fold. There are more than 100 metabolic disorders which can be detected in a newborn urine sample.

Who is the author of the republic act 9288?

The author of Republic Act 9288, also known as the "Newborn Screening Act," is the Congress of the Philippines. The act was enacted on March 21, 2004, and aims to promote early detection and prevention of certain diseases in newborns through screening programs.
